Block

#12,818,811
Block Number
12,818,811 @ 07/25/2022, 24:49:50
Status
Finalized
ID
0x00c3997bf1d7ad9dda085defde35036136b5095a9eb72fb9faa1e8373a821c22
Transactions
Gas Used
18534228/20856693 (88.86% Used)
Total Score
1,244,704,460 (+98)
Rewards
56.08 VTHO